INTERNSHIP WORKSHOP SERIES: How to Find An Internship
Description:
Not sure where to start with your internship search -- or feel like you're at a standstill and not sure about the next steps to take? Learn more about resources available to help you research internship opportunities, strategies to connect with UMD alumni to network with industry professionals, and how to best market yourself on your resume and during interviews.
This workshop is part of the Jump-Start Your Internship Search Certificate Program, where students can earn a professional portfolio and a certificate in four easy steps while gaining insight into the internship search process. Find out more about the certificate here: www.Careers.umd.edu/InternshipCertificate
This workshop is intended for all students, not just Jump-Start Your Internship Search Certificate participants.
